Web20 dec. 2024 · Anatomy. Function. Associated Conditions. Tests. Surrounding the brain and spinal cord are three layers of protective tissue, collectively called the meninges . Meninges are a necessary cushion between these vital organs and the cranium (or skull) and vertebrae (spine). They also prevent cerebrospinal fluid (CSF), the clear fluid the brain …
Web20 dec. 2024 · Cortical laminae differ in neuronal content but also in their connectivity to other parts of the brain. The relative sizes of laminae vary across the cortex in line with their functions and connectivity. For example, thalamocortical connections arrive primarily in central (granular) layers.
